// Next.js (nextjs@1.0.0)
// Palette: nextjs@1.0.0
// Fonts:   heading=geist@1.0.0, body=geist@1.0.0, mono=geist-mono@1.0.0
// Generated by brand-atoms converter — do not edit by hand.

// ─── Swatches ─────────────────────────────────────────
$swatch-next-black: #000000;
$swatch-next-white: #FFFFFF;
$swatch-dark-bg-100: #0A0A0A;
$swatch-dark-gray-100: #1A1A1A;
$swatch-dark-gray-300: #292929;
$swatch-dark-gray-500: #454545;
$swatch-dark-gray-900: #A1A1A1;
$swatch-dark-gray-1000: #EDEDED;
$swatch-light-bg-200: #FAFAFA;
$swatch-light-gray-200: #EAEAEA;
$swatch-light-gray-600: #666666;
$swatch-light-gray-1000: #171717;
$swatch-vercel-blue: #0070F3;
$swatch-vercel-blue-bright: #52A8FF;
$swatch-vercel-red: #FF6166;
$swatch-vercel-amber: #F2A60D;
$swatch-vercel-green: #62C073;

// ─── Light-mode role mappings ─────────────────────────
$light-background: $swatch-light-bg-200;
$light-surface: $swatch-next-white;
$light-surface-elevated: $swatch-next-white;
$light-text-primary: $swatch-light-gray-1000;
$light-text-secondary: $swatch-light-gray-600;
$light-text-tertiary: $swatch-dark-gray-500;
$light-primary: $swatch-next-black;
$light-primary-hover: $swatch-light-gray-1000;
$light-accent: $swatch-vercel-blue;
$light-accent-hover: $swatch-vercel-blue-bright;
$light-warning: $swatch-vercel-amber;
$light-warning-hover: $swatch-vercel-amber;
$light-error: $swatch-vercel-red;
$light-success: $swatch-vercel-green;

// ─── Dark-mode role mappings ──────────────────────────
$dark-background: $swatch-dark-bg-100;
$dark-surface: $swatch-dark-gray-100;
$dark-surface-elevated: $swatch-dark-gray-300;
$dark-text-primary: $swatch-dark-gray-1000;
$dark-text-secondary: $swatch-dark-gray-900;
$dark-text-tertiary: $swatch-dark-gray-500;
$dark-primary: $swatch-next-white;
$dark-primary-hover: $swatch-dark-gray-1000;
$dark-accent: $swatch-vercel-blue-bright;
$dark-accent-hover: $swatch-vercel-blue;
$dark-warning: $swatch-vercel-amber;
$dark-warning-hover: $swatch-vercel-amber;
$dark-error: $swatch-vercel-red;
$dark-success: $swatch-vercel-green;

// ─── Brand-level color role overrides ─────────────────
$brand-identity: $swatch-next-black;
$brand-on-identity: $swatch-next-white;
$brand-primary: $swatch-next-black;
$brand-primary-hover: $swatch-light-gray-1000;
$brand-accent: $swatch-vercel-blue;
$brand-accent-hover: $swatch-vercel-blue-bright;
$brand-background: $swatch-light-bg-200;
$brand-surface: $swatch-next-white;
$brand-text-primary: $swatch-light-gray-1000;
$brand-text-secondary: $swatch-light-gray-600;

// ─── Typography ───────────────────────────────────────
$font-heading: (Geist, -apple-system, BlinkMacSystemFont, 'Segoe UI', Helvetica, Arial, sans-serif);
$font-body: (Geist, -apple-system, BlinkMacSystemFont, 'Segoe UI', Helvetica, Arial, sans-serif);
$font-mono: ('Geist Mono', SFMono-Regular, Menlo, Monaco, Consolas, 'Liberation Mono', 'Courier New', monospace);

// ─── Iteration maps ───────────────────────────────────
$swatches: (
  "next-black": $swatch-next-black,
  "next-white": $swatch-next-white,
  "dark-bg-100": $swatch-dark-bg-100,
  "dark-gray-100": $swatch-dark-gray-100,
  "dark-gray-300": $swatch-dark-gray-300,
  "dark-gray-500": $swatch-dark-gray-500,
  "dark-gray-900": $swatch-dark-gray-900,
  "dark-gray-1000": $swatch-dark-gray-1000,
  "light-bg-200": $swatch-light-bg-200,
  "light-gray-200": $swatch-light-gray-200,
  "light-gray-600": $swatch-light-gray-600,
  "light-gray-1000": $swatch-light-gray-1000,
  "vercel-blue": $swatch-vercel-blue,
  "vercel-blue-bright": $swatch-vercel-blue-bright,
  "vercel-red": $swatch-vercel-red,
  "vercel-amber": $swatch-vercel-amber,
  "vercel-green": $swatch-vercel-green,
);

$light-roles: (
  "background": $light-background,
  "surface": $light-surface,
  "surface-elevated": $light-surface-elevated,
  "text-primary": $light-text-primary,
  "text-secondary": $light-text-secondary,
  "text-tertiary": $light-text-tertiary,
  "primary": $light-primary,
  "primary-hover": $light-primary-hover,
  "accent": $light-accent,
  "accent-hover": $light-accent-hover,
  "warning": $light-warning,
  "warning-hover": $light-warning-hover,
  "error": $light-error,
  "success": $light-success,
);

$dark-roles: (
  "background": $dark-background,
  "surface": $dark-surface,
  "surface-elevated": $dark-surface-elevated,
  "text-primary": $dark-text-primary,
  "text-secondary": $dark-text-secondary,
  "text-tertiary": $dark-text-tertiary,
  "primary": $dark-primary,
  "primary-hover": $dark-primary-hover,
  "accent": $dark-accent,
  "accent-hover": $dark-accent-hover,
  "warning": $dark-warning,
  "warning-hover": $dark-warning-hover,
  "error": $dark-error,
  "success": $dark-success,
);
